- Sarthak GaurApr 14, 2025 · 7 months agoBitcoin (BTC) and Ethereum (ETH) are currently the most popular digital currencies in Poland. They have a strong presence in the market due to their widespread recognition and acceptance. Bitcoin, being the first and most well-known cryptocurrency, has established itself as a store of value and a medium of exchange. Ethereum, on the other hand, is popular for its smart contract capabilities and its role in powering decentralized applications (DApps). Both cryptocurrencies have a large user base and are widely traded on various exchanges in Poland.
